Chambers County, located in east central Alabama, is a region steeped in history and culture. With its county seat in LaFayette and the largest city in Valley, the county provides a serene escape for those interested in exploring local history. Named in honor of U.S. Senator Henry H. Chambers, the county is part of the LaGrange, GA-AL Micropolitan Statistical Area. Visitors can enjoy the historical architecture, including the notable Chambers County Courthouse, and immerse themselves in the local culture and community life.

Spring is a pleasant time to visit with mild temperatures and blooming landscapes.
Summers can be hot, but it's a great time for outdoor activities and local events.
Fall offers cooler weather and beautiful foliage, perfect for exploring the countryside.
Winters are mild, making it a good time for indoor activities and historical tours.
